I want to know where the very very best place to shop is in or around Chattanooga. I'll be coming down there in September with a non-quilting friend - so will only push it enough to go to one shop.
Carol B Hancock's on Brainerd Road Lavender Lime on South Terrace - http://www.lavenderlimeinspires.com/ Hobby Lobby at Hamilton Place Mall (also a HL in Hixson and Dalton, but Hamilton Place has the largest store) And I believe there's a shop in Ringgold (GA) called Sew-Bee-It. I've never been there, but they have a website. It looks like a neat store. http://www.sew-bee-it.com/ As far as which is the best, Lavender Lime is a nifty store. Hobby Lobby's probably got the largest selection, though. And Hancock's is okay overall, but the store is rather messy and the aisle are very narrow. I heard that we're getting a Joann's this fall, but I don't know the exact date or where the store will be located. |
